About the Role:

As a Public Protection Officer, you will play a crucial role in delivering a comprehensive food hygiene and standards inspection programme. Your responsibilities will include:

  • Investigating complaints related to food and health & safety matters.
  • Assisting in health & safety at work initiatives and accident investigations.
  • Conducting inspections for infectious disease control.
  • Providing expert comments on licencing and planning applications.
  • Participating in event consultations.

In this regulatory position, you will ensure compliance with the Council's enforcement policy, providing guidance, responding to complaints, and serving notices when necessary. Your role may also involve attending court and hearings to present evidence and lead prosecutions.
